What is NTSE Application

The NTSE Stage-2 Application Form is a scholarship application used by students in India to apply for the National Talent Search Examination (NTSE) scholarship.

Comprehensive Guide to NTSE Application

What is the NTSE Stage-2 Application Form?

The NTSE Stage-2 Application Form is a crucial document for students aiming to apply for scholarship opportunities through the National Talent Search Examination (NTSE). This form serves as the gateway to accessing merit-based financial assistance for academic endeavors. Understanding this application form is vital for navigating the NTSE scholarship application process.
The NTSE is an esteemed examination in India, recognized for identifying and nurturing talented students. Applicants benefit from the NTSE scholarship, which can significantly facilitate their educational pursuits.

Who Needs the NTSE Stage-2 Application Form?

The NTSE Stage-2 Application Form is designed for students in specific grades who meet the eligibility criteria established by the examination authorities. Typically, students in Class 10 are the primary candidates.
Additionally, parents or guardians play a crucial role in this process, as their signatures are required on the form to validate the application. Understanding who needs to complete this form is essential for a seamless application experience.

Information You'll Need to Gather Before Applying

Before starting the application process, it's important to gather relevant personal information and documentation. This includes:
  • Name and address details.
  • School information, including class and enrollment details.
  • Academic records, such as report cards.
Having these documents ready will streamline the process of completing the application form.

Common Errors to Avoid When Completing the NTSE Stage-2 Application Form

To ensure a successful submission, applicants should be aware of common mistakes that can lead to application rejection. Some frequent issues include:
  • Omitting signatures from the applicant or parent/guardian.
  • Providing incorrect or incomplete personal information.
A validation checklist before submission can help applicants avoid these pitfalls and enhance the quality of their submission.
